How Do Microscopes Contribute to Advances in Cell Biology?

Microscopes are super important in the study of cell biology. They help scientists make exciting discoveries about the basic building blocks of life—cells!

With microscopes, researchers can explore the amazing details of cell structures that we can’t see with just our eyes. Let’s take a look at some cool types of microscopes and what they do:

  1. Light Microscopes:

    • These are the most common type!
    • They use regular light to magnify things up to 1,000 times bigger.
    • This way, we can see the shape and arrangement of cells, which is great for watching live cells as they work!
  2. Electron Microscopes:

    • These are really strong tools that can magnify things up to 2 million times!
    • They show us amazing details of cell structures, called organelles, helping us learn how they work.
  3. Fluorescence Microscopes:

    • These microscopes use special dyes that glow to highlight certain parts of cells.
    • This technology helps us see complicated processes happening inside the cell, like how cells send signals to each other!

Thanks to these microscopes, we can discover the secrets of cell biology. This knowledge can lead to big advances in medicine, genetics, and more! Isn’t that incredible?
